Article title

Why May Teachers Become Cynical at Work? Predictors of Organizational Cynicism among Polish Teachers - Research Report

The manuscript presents an exploratory study on the possible sources of organizational cynicism among Polish teachers. A sample of 157 teachers participated in the study. The results show that important positive predictors of organizational cynicism among teachers are continuance commitment and work-family conflict, whereas affective commitment is a negative predictor.
